Lee County Fla Dec 29 2012 A Naples woman is facing charges of trespassing and resisting an officer without violence after Lee County Port Authority Police say she was involved in an incident with ticket agents at Southwest Florida International Airport this morning.
Police say they were called to the Spirit Airlines ticket counter around 5:27 a.m. about a disgruntled passenger and met with Nana Mimura, 45, and Alex Zampeiri, who were arguing with ticket agents.
Police say the couple was told they had to leave the area and Zampeiri told police the airline was “ripping me off.”
Police say both Zampeiri and Mimura initially refused to leave the area, but when Zampeiri finally began to cooperate, Mimura refused and took out her iPhone to record the agents.
Police say she was screaming and cursing at the agents and pulled away from police as the couple was being escorted away from the counter.
Police placed her under arrest for trespassing, but she continued to resist as they tried to place handcuffs on her.
